




I recently spent a week testing the Nostalgic 3.5-inch Retro Android Gaming TV to see if it delivers on its promise of marrying vintage charm with modern utility. It is certainly a conversation starter that brings a unique physical presence to any gaming setup.
The device feels surprisingly sturdy for its size, sporting a rigid frame that successfully mimics the look of a classic CRT. The screen clarity is crisp enough for retro gaming sessions, and the controls feel tactile and responsive enough for casual play.
Getting the Android interface running was straightforward, though the small screen size makes touch navigation a bit challenging for those with larger hands. Once configured, however, it serves as a fantastic dedicated station for classic emulators and light media viewing.
This is the perfect gift for retro tech fans who want a functional, decorative piece that doubles as a capable portable gaming system.
Overall, the Nostalgic 3.5-inch Retro TV earns a solid 4 out of 5 rating for its design and charm. At $249, it acts as a premium novelty that bridges the gap between display piece and playable hardware.
